Community Council Decision

The Toronto and East York Community Council:

 

1. Authorized the General Manager, Transportation Services to enter into an Encroachment Agreement with property owner of 45 Montye Avenue, to permit a wooden fence, subject but not limited to, the following conditions:

 

a. indemnify the City from and against all actions, suits, claims or demands and from all loss, costs, damages, and expenses that may result from such permission granted;

 

b. maintain the wooden fence at their own expense in good repair and a condition satisfactory to the General Manager, Transportation Services and will not make any additions or modifications to the encroachment beyond what is allowed under the terms of the Agreement;

 

c. accept such additional conditions as the City Solicitor or the General Manager, Transportation Services may deem necessary in the interest of the City;

 

d. remove the wooden fence upon receiving written notice to do so;

 

e. the property owner will enter into an Encroachment Agreement with the City of Toronto, at the applicant's expense, and assume all liability and damages related to the encroachments; and

 

f. no spikes or pointed tops are permitted on the fence, gate or pillars.

Summary

This staff report is about a matter that Community Council has delegated authority from City Council to make a final decision.

 

The purpose of this report is for Toronto East York Community Council to consider an appeal from the property owner of 45 Montye Avenue regarding their encroachment application. The encroachment consists of a wooden fence which is in contravention of City of Toronto Municipal Code Chapter 743, Streets and Sidewalks, Use Of.

 

The property owner is seeking authority from Toronto East York Community Council to allow a wooden fence to be maintained within the public right-of-way at 45 Montye Avenue, which is in contravention of Toronto Municipal Code Chapter 743, Streets and Sidewalks, Use Of.
